PSL Eight, Peshawar Zalmi defeated Islamabad United by 13 runs
Rawalpindi (Web Desk) – In the 29th match of Pakistan Super League (PSL) eight, Peshawar Zalmi defeated Islamabad United by 13 runs.
Chasing the target of 180 runs, the Islamabad United team was bowled out for 166 runs in 19.4 overs. All-rounder Faheem Ashraf became the top scorer by scoring 38 runs, Rahmanullah Gurbaz scored 33 runs, captain Shadab Khan scored 25 runs.
On behalf of Peshawar Zalmi, Khurram Shehzad and Sufyan Moqim took 3, 3 wickets while Aamir Jamal and James Neesham took 2 and 2 wickets respectively.
Earlier, Peshawar Zalmi scored 179 runs for the loss of 8 wickets in the allotted 20 overs when batting first. Opener Mohammad Haris played an impressive innings of 79 runs off 39 balls with the help of 5 sixes and 7 fours.
On behalf of Islamabad United, Hasan Ali took 3 wickets while Shadab Khan took 2 wickets.
